> +/// CollectIvarsToConstructOrDestruct - Collect those ivars which require
> +/// construction (construct=true) or destruction (construct=false)
> +///
> +void ASTContext::CollectIvarsToConstructOrDestruct(const ObjCInterfaceDecl *OI,
> +                                llvm::SmallVectorImpl<ObjCIvarDecl*> &Ivars,
> +                                bool construct) {
> +  if (!getLangOptions().CPlusPlus)
> +    return;
> +  for (ObjCInterfaceDecl::ivar_iterator I = OI->ivar_begin(),
> +       E = OI->ivar_end(); I != E; ++I) {
> +    ObjCIvarDecl *Iv = (*I);
> +    if (const RecordType *RT = Iv->getType()->getAs<RecordType>()) {

We also need to find ivars that are arrays of class type; I suggest using getBaseElementType(Iv->getType()).

> +      if (const CXXRecordDecl *RD = dyn_cast<CXXRecordDecl>(RT->getDecl()))
> +        if (construct && !RD->hasTrivialConstructor() ||
> +            !construct && !RD->hasTrivialDestructor())
> +          Ivars.push_back(*I);
> +    }
> +  }
